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2007.11.18;
Скачать: CL | DM;

Вниз

TExcelApplication   Найти похожие ветки 

 
MaximusI   (2007-10-28 13:25) [0]

Делаю экспорт в эксель, для тестов делаю видимым окно ExcelApplication1.Visible[0] := True;

в конце экспорта сохраняю файл реузультата:
     ExcelApplication1.ActiveWorkBook.SaveAs(ChangeFileExt(FileName, ".xls"), xlWorkbookNormal, "", "", False, False, xlNoChange, xlLocalSessionChanges, False, EmptyParam, EmptyParam, EmptyParam, 0);
     ExcelApplication1.ActiveWorkbook.Close(False, EmptyParam, EmptyParam, 0);


Но при видимом окне получается, что если файл уже существует, происходит запрос в экселе: "Файл ... уже существует в данном месте. Заменить?"

Как можно избежать данного запроса?


 
Palladin ©   (2007-10-28 13:31) [1]

ExcelApplication1.DisplayAlerts:=False


 
MaximusI   (2007-10-28 13:34) [2]

Спасибо, помогло.

Я сначала увидел .AlertBeforeOverwriting думал что это оно; но не помоголо, зачем тогда нужен AlertBeforeOverwriting?


 
Palladin ©   (2007-10-28 13:47) [3]

оно не имеет к сохранению никакого отношения... открой справку в Excel по VBA в частности по Excel.Application и наслаждайся

AlertBeforeOverwriting Property

True if Microsoft Excel displays a message before overwriting nonblank cells during a drag-and-drop editing operation. Read/write Boolean



Страницы: 1 вся ветка

Текущий архив: 2007.11.18;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.015 c
2-1193041648
alll_23
2007-10-22 12:27
2007.11.18
TTreeView


1-1188460255
Kolan
2007-08-30 11:50
2007.11.18
Disabled кнопка тулбара с Enabled выпадающим списком, возможно?


3-1182264642
Fredy314
2007-06-19 18:50
2007.11.18
Выборка за месяц по дням


9-1158705238
Аццкий_рыцарь
2006-09-20 02:33
2007.11.18
Прошу мастеров посмотреть


15-1192011879
maverik
2007-10-10 14:24
2007.11.18
Библиотека для проигрывателя